Man on Probation in Georgia Accused of Hit and Run
A hit and run accident proved fatal for two department of transportation workers in South Carolina earlier in March. The state's highway patrol investigated the incident and they now believe that they know what happened.According to reports, a man who was on probation in Georgia was traveli